Admission Process:-

The minimum educational requirements required for B.Sc Radiography Technology admission are mentioned below:-

  • Must have passed Higher Secondary School Certificate Examination (12 years course) (or) Senior School Certificate Examination (10+2) (or) Pre-degree Examination (10+2) (or) an equivalent with 12 years schooling from a recognized Board or University in the following group of subjects: 

  1. Physics, Chemistry, Botany and Zoology (or)

  2.  Physics, Chemistry, Biology or Mathematics with any other subject

  • The minimum percentage required for admission is 40%. 

  • And a for the candidates belonging to the SC/ST candidates, the minimum percentage for the admission is 35%

Selection Process:-

Candidates need to appear for the entrance exam conducted by the Cancer Institute (CIC), Chennai. Based on the entrance score they will be shortlisted and will be called for the personal interview round.
